Player 1: Aaron Ramsdale

The first player I’d like to introduce is goalkeeper Aaron Ramsdale. Ramsdale is only 23 years old, but he is a promising player who has been selected for the England national team. Like Tomiyasu, Ramsdale moved to the club this season and immediately took over the position from Bernd Leno, a talented player in the German national team.
Ramsdell’s strength of character is that he has a lot of heart, and at 23 years old, you’d think he’d be a little intimidated by the prospect of guarding the goal for Arsenal, but the England goalkeeper doesn’t seem to be in the least bit intimidated. Even in a pinch, he calmly defends the goal and inspires his fellow defenders with a loud voice. He is the next generation of goalkeepers, with excellent saves and skills at his feet.

Player 3: Kieran Tierney

Scotland’s attacking left back, Tierney comes from the Scottish Celtic lower division, and in an interview when he was a boy, he said that he admired Shunsuke Nakamura, who also played for Celtic. Like the former Japan national team legend, Tierney’s strong point is his accurate left foot, and he uses his speed to break through vertically and shoot accurate crosses from there. He is a tenacious defender as well as an attacker, and sometimes plays left back in a back three for the Scottish national team, with his colleague Andrew Robertson of Liverpool, one of the world’s leading left backs.
Such a left back for Scotland is also known for being a common man, which is rare for a footballer these days. While other players use brand-name bags as their traveling bags, Tierney’s photo of using Tesco (a common supermarket in England) shopping bags became a hot topic on SNS.

Player 5: Emile Smith Rowe

A midfielder from the lower divisions, Smith Rowe made his first start of the season last December against Chelsea, and with one assist, he quickly found his place and increased his opportunities. Since then, he has grown steadily, and even though he is only 21 years old, he has been carrying the ace number 10 since this season. Arsenal’s number 10 has been worn by Dutch national team legends such as Dennis Bergkamp, Robin van Persie, and former German international Mesut Özil. Listening to this, you can tell how much the leaders are expecting from Smith Rowe.
The England U-21 midfielder is not very fast, nor does he have great technique (although he does have above average speed and technique). So why is he playing number 10 for a big club like Arsenal? Smith Rowe’s main asset is his positioning. He is a clever midfielder who can always think about how to make the most of his teammates and how to make them uncomfortable.
